In 2016, Gail had a § 179 deduction carryover of $30,000. In 2017, she elected § 179 for an asset acquired at a cost of $115,000. Gail's § 179 business income limitation for 2017 is $140,000. Determine Gail's § 179 deduction for 2017.
Expenditures
Expenditures are the expenses incurred by individuals, businesses, or governments in paying for goods and services.
Benefits-received Principle
This principle suggests that individuals should pay taxes in proportion to the benefits they receive from government services.
Taxation
The process by which a government imposes charges on citizens and corporate entities to finance government spending and public services.
Gasoline Tax
A tax imposed by governments on the sale of gasoline, typically used to fund transportation-related projects.
